Integrity group hails Senator Dickson’s impactful representation

The Niger Delta Integrity Group has praised Senator Seriake Dickson as a champion for the people of Nigeria, particularly the Ijaw Nation and the Niger Delta Region.
The group made this known during a consultative meeting in Sagbama town, in Bayelsa.
“Dickson’s unwavering commitment to impactful legislation has brought tangible benefits to our nation, from improving healthcare access, true and equitable federalism, taxation, to fostering national economic growth,” said Comrade Jeremiah Okuboebi, Spokesman of the group.
The group noted that Senator Dickson’s deep understanding of the needs of his constituents and his ability to navigate the complexities of the legislative process has made him an invaluable asset to the Nigerian nation beyond his electoral geography.
“He is a national asset and should be insulated from the vagaries and vicissitudes of local politics of zoning,” the group asserted.
The Integrity Group described Senator Dickson as a voice for the voiceless, an advocate for the minorities.
“Champions like Senator Dickson not only influence public policy but add value to the integrity and solidity of the Senate,” the group stated.
The group urged the people of Bayelsa West senatorial district to cast their votes for Senator Dickson in the upcoming elections
so that he could continue his vital work for the betterment of the people of Bayelsa and Nigeria at large.
“Senator Dickson represents a beacon of hope for the marginalised for a brighter future for Nigeria,” the group said.
The Integrity group expressed dismay at a section of constituents pushing for the zoning or rotation principle, arguing that it was a convenient label for mediocrity.
“The incontrovertible truth is that Champions are never replaced. Rewarding outstanding performance is one of the indicators that our democracy is maturing,” the group reiterated.
On his part, the Acting Deputy President of the Group, Barr Caroline Okpe, vowed to mobilise all progressives in Bayelsa State and beyond to support Senator Dickson ahead of the 2027 elections to ensure that he is returned as a consensus candidate of any political platform he chooses to contest.
